摘要
The concentration of particulate Cs-137 in paddy fields, which can be a major source of Cs-137 entering the water system, was studied following the Fukushima Daiichi Nuclear Power Plant accident. To parametrize the concentration and to estimate the time dependence, paddy fields covering various levels of Cs-137 deposition were investigated over the period 2011-2013 (n = 121). The particulate Cs-137 concentration (kBq kg(_ss)(-1)) showed a significant correlation with the initial surface deposition density (kBq m(-2)). This suggests that the entrainment coefficient (m(2) kg(-ss)(-1)), defined as the ratio between the particulate Cs-137 concentration and the initial surface deposition density, is an important parameter when modeling Cs-137 wash-off from paddy fields. The entrainment coefficient decreased with time following a double exponential function. The decrease rate constant of the entrainment coefficient was clearly higher than that reported for other land uses for river water. The difference in the decrease rates of the entrainment coefficient suggests that paddy fields play a major role in radiocesium migration through the water system. An understanding of the decrease rate of the entrainment coefficient of paddy fields is therefore crucial to understand the migration of radiocesium in the water system.
